Hakim Ziyech departs from Wydad after a brief stint in Casablanca
Hakim Ziyech's journey at Wydad Casablanca comes to an unexpected end. The Casablanca club announced on Sunday the amicable termination of the contract with the Moroccan international, thus concluding a collaboration that began less than a year ago.
Arriving with high expectations surrounding his return to Moroccan football, the attacking midfielder ultimately leaves Wydad after a short-lived experience. The separation comes by mutual agreement between the two parties, without either detailing the precise reasons for this decision.
Wydad officially announces the separation
In a message posted on its social media, Wydad confirmed the conclusion of an agreement with the player to end their engagement. The club also took the time to pay tribute to Ziyech's time in their colors.
The Casablanca team adopted a particularly warm tone to announce this departure, emphasizing that the duration of a collaboration does not necessarily measure its importance. Wydad assured that the Moroccan international would remain linked to the club's "family" and wished him well for the continuation of his career.
A Casablanca chapter that ends quickly
Ziyech's departure marks a turning point in a journey that had generated significant interest upon his arrival. After playing for several major European clubs, including Ajax Amsterdam and Chelsea, the Moroccan player had chosen to continue his career at Wydad.
His time in Casablanca turned out to be quite brief. This amicable termination now opens a new chapter in the player's career, while his sporting future remains to be determined.
For Wydad, this separation also represents an important change in the composition of its squad. The club will now have to continue its season without one of the players whose arrival had marked its recent news.
A future now in limbo
At this stage, no official indication has been communicated regarding Hakim Ziyech's next destination. The end of his contract with Wydad now allows him to consider a new direction for the continuation of his career.
This swift rupture primarily ends a highly followed sequence in Moroccan football: that of a return of an internationally experienced player to one of the most popular clubs in the country.
